What are the best times to visit West Lake?

Experience the changing beauty of West Lake throughout the seasons, from the fresh spring air to the romantic fall colors, making it a year-round destination. Plan your visit in the late afternoon and evening to enjoy cooler temperatures and witness the vibrant local life. May and June are ideal for viewing the lotus fields, while sunset offers a mesmerizing spectacle.
How can I get to West Lake?

West Lake is approximately 2 miles from the Old Quarter, easily accessible by taxi. You can also take buses, motorcycle taxis through ride-hailing apps, or rent a bicycle to explore the area at your own pace. Combine your visit with nearby attractions like Ho Chi Minh Mausoleum and One Pillar Pagoda for a comprehensive experience.

What to know about West Lake
Remarkable Landmarks and Must-Visit Sights
Tran Quoc Pagoda
Visit Vietnam's oldest temple, Tran Quoc Pagoda, built in the 6th century on a small island in the lake. Admire the rich history and cultural significance of this iconic landmark.
Tay Ho Temple
Experience the sacred ambiance of Tay Ho Temple, a revered site on a peninsula in West Lake where visitors come to pray for good luck and peace.
Kim Lien Pagoda
Explore the 12th-century Kim Lien Pagoda, one of the oldest architectural monuments in Vietnam, known for its complex and elegant architecture.

Cultural and Historical Significance
West Lake boasts numerous historic attractions, including Tran Quoc Pagoda, Quan Thanh Temple, and Van Nien Pagoda, reflecting the rich cultural heritage of Vietnam. Explore these sites to delve into the country's fascinating history.
History and Culture
West Lake holds significant historical importance, with legends dating back to Vietnamese folklore. The lake's surroundings are dotted with temples, pagodas, and schools that reflect the rich cultural heritage of Hanoi.
